A well-established Mechanical & Electrical contractor is seeking an experienced Mechanical Contract Manager to join its growing operations team. As part of continued growth, an opportunity has arisen for a Mechanical Contract Manager to oversee multiple projects and support the successful delivery of mechanical works from pre-construction through to completion.

The successful candidate will take responsibility for the operational delivery of mechanical projects, ensuring client expectations, programme requirements and commercial objectives are consistently achieved. Typical duties will include:

  • Managing mechanical projects from award through to handover
  • Coordinating project teams, subcontractors and specialist suppliers
  • Monitoring project progress, resources and programme performance
  • Attending client, consultant and site meetings
  • Supporting procurement and supply chain activities
  • Managing variations and working closely with commercial teams
  • Overseeing commissioning and final completion stages
  • Ensuring compliance with health, safety and quality standards

What We're Looking For:

  • Previous experience within a Mechanical Contract Manager position
  • Strong Building Services or M&E contracting background
  • Sound knowledge of HVAC and mechanical systems
  • Experience delivering commercial building services projects
  • Strong leadership and communication skills
  • Ability to manage multiple stakeholders and project priorities
